
Suggest Remedy For Discolouration Under Eyes

Question: Hi,
I just notice a blueish area in the skin of my right eye socket, about half an inch below the eye. No trauma that i can think of. Do have new prescription for glasses which are quite different from my old but that seems an unlikely source.
I just notice a blueish area in the skin of my right eye socket, about half an inch below the eye. No trauma that i can think of. Do have new prescription for glasses which are quite different from my old but that seems an unlikely source.
Brief Answer:
hemorrhage
Detailed Answer:
My dear,
Thanks for sending your query to us.
This ismost likely to be bleeding under the skin. There is no mention in your medical history of medication being taken by you. Drugs like aspirin can cause this type of bleeding without injury.You have righly noticed this being unrelated to glasses.
This will resolve in about 2 weeks time.If large Thrombophobe ointment helps in early resolution and usually no treatment is needed.
